What are the most common challenges faced in electronic component procurement, and how can they be managed effectively?

One of the most common challenges in electronic component procurement is managing supply chain disruptions and component shortages, especially for high-demand or obsolete parts. Professionals in this role need to develop strong relationships with multiple suppliers, stay updated on market trends, and implement robust inventory management strategies to mitigate risks. Effective communication with engineering and production teams is essential to ensure timely substitutions and to avoid production delays. By leveraging forecasting tools and negotiating favorable contracts, procurement specialists can minimize the impact of market volatility and ensure a steady supply of critical components.

What is electronic component procurement?

Electronic component procurement is the process of sourcing, purchasing, and managing electronic parts and materials needed for manufacturing electronic products. This involves identifying reliable suppliers, negotiating prices, ensuring component quality, and managing supply chain logistics to ensure timely delivery. Professionals in this field must stay up to date with market trends, component availability, and potential supply chain disruptions. Effective procurement helps manufacturers maintain production schedules and control costs while ensuring product quality.

What is the difference between Electronic Component Procurement vs Electronic Component Purchasing?

AspectElectronic Component ProcurementElectronic Component Purchasing
ResponsibilitiesStrategic sourcing, supplier negotiations, contract managementOrder placement, price negotiation, order tracking
FocusLong-term supplier relationships and supply chain managementImmediate purchase transactions and cost savings
CredentialsSupply chain or procurement certifications often preferredPurchasing certifications or experience
Work EnvironmentSupply chain departments, procurement teamsPurchasing departments, procurement offices

Electronic Component Procurement involves strategic sourcing and supplier management, focusing on long-term supply chain stability. Electronic Component Purchasing centers on executing purchase orders and negotiating prices for immediate needs. While both roles require negotiation skills, procurement emphasizes planning and supplier relationships, whereas purchasing emphasizes transaction execution.
